S7-1200V90PN转矩功能实现案例分享 点击:7561 | 回复:0



李东泽

    
  • [版主]
  • 精华:7帖
  • 求助:25帖
  • 帖子:1209帖 | 6375回
  • 年度积分:216
  • 历史总积分:44409
  • 注册:2010年3月25日
发表于:2019-08-02 13:30:27
楼主

在收放卷应用中为了减少CPU的负荷率可以采用不组态速度轴工艺对象,而直接发送驱动报文的控制字、速度给定、转矩限幅及附加转矩给定。可以在标准报文102上增加750附加报文,转矩给定及转矩上下限幅给定标定时16#4000H对应驱动中的参考转矩值P2003。

1. 对驱动的要求
V90 PN驱动采用速度控制模式,使用新固件FW V1.3,它支持附加报文750,可在标准报文上增加750附加报文来实现轴的转矩限幅及附加转矩给定功能。

2. 调试软件要求
1. 用于Portal V15/V15 SP1平台的V90 HSP0185 或GSD文件(GSDML_file_v2.32_sinamcis_v90pn_20180321)
对于1200 PLC只能使用GSD文件
2. V-assistant v1.05.05

3. 实现方法

(1) 如果使用HSP组态V90 PN(1500PLC),在网络视图中为V90 PN驱动配置控制报文,在"报文"处选择"西门子报文102, PZD-6/10"用于轴的速度控制,在"附加报文"处选择"附加报文750,PZD 3/1"用于附加转矩及转矩限幅控制:


注意:配置项目时,需要在同步域设置中将PLC及V90均设置为RT“未同步”模式:

 


(2) 如果使用GSD文件组态V90 PN(1200/1500PLC),在设备视图中为V90 PN驱动配置控制报文,分别添加"西门子报文102, PZD-6/10"用于轴的速度控制及"附加报文750,PZD 3/1"用于附加转矩及转矩限幅控制:

(4) 轴的控制编程:

750报文包含:
3个控制字:分别为附加转矩给定、转矩上限幅及转矩下限幅
1个状态字:实际转矩
注意:转矩给定及转矩上下限幅给定值16进制的4000H代表驱动中的p2003。编程时转矩上限幅及转矩下限幅必须给定设定值,否则驱动中转矩限幅为0。

 V90 PN可以不创建工艺轴进行直接转矩控制吗?

可以,V90 PN需使用新固件FW V1.3,在标准报文102上增加750附加报文:
• V90 PN可以编写程序激活控制字STW 1.14使其进行转矩控制模式,通过750报文的附件转矩给定发送转矩设定值。
• V90 PTI可以通过模拟量进行转矩控制

 轴工艺对象可以进行转矩限幅控制吗?

可以,V90 PN需使用新固件FW V1.3,在标准报文上增加750附加报文:
1500(T) PLC 需Portal V15/V15 SP1 及对应的V90 HSP0185,可以通过"MC_TorqueAdditive" 命令给定附加转矩值,"MC_TorqueLimiting"命令来激活并指定力矩/扭矩限制。

 PLC中不创建轴工艺对象可以进行转矩限幅控制吗?

可以,V90 PN需使用新固件FW V1.3,在标准报文102上增加750附加报文。在收放卷应用中为了减少CPU的负荷率可以采用不组态速度轴工艺对象,而直接发送轴的控制字、速度给定、转矩限幅及附加转矩给定。

注意:转矩给定及转矩上下限幅给定16#4000H代表驱动中的参考转矩值P2003。

750报文包括哪些控制字及状态字?

附加报文750,PZD 3/1包含:
•3个控制字,分别为附加转矩给定、转矩上限幅及转矩下限幅。
•1个状态字:实际转矩

来源西门子技术支持,不敢私藏分享给大家,我在做项目时咨询的得到文档

1分不嫌少!


楼主最近还看过


热门招聘
相关主题

官方公众号

智造工程师